Indiana Statutes § 3-9-1-25.5 Calendar year in which contribution made
Statute Text
For purposes of this article, a person makes a contribution during the calendar year in which the person relinquishes control over the contribution by:
(1)
depositing the contribution in the United States mail; or
(2)
transferring the contribution to any other person who has been directed to convey the contribution to the person intended to be the recipient of the contribution.
History
As added by P.L. 176 - 1999 , SEC.40.
